a) Write the IUPAC name of the complex K3[Cr(C2O4)3].

b) Draw the gure to show the splitting of ‘d’ orbitals in octahedral crystal eld. 

c) [Fe(H2O6)3- ] is strongly paramagnetic, whereas [Fe(CN6)]3- is weakly paramagnetic. Write the reason.

a) Potassium trioxalatochromate(lll)

c) H2O is a weaker ligand compared to CN. There is no pairing of electrons in the d-orbital of Fe in [Fe(H2O)6]3+. But there is the pairing of electrons in the d-orbital of Fe in [Fe(CN6)]3-.
